Merilyn Richards

July 21, 1932 — November 25, 2019

Merilyn Jean Chaffee Richards passed away on November 25th, 2019, peacefully at the Koebacker house after a long illness. Merilyn was the fourth child born to Mabel Laura Rebecca (Staib) Chaffee and the Rev. Dr. Merrill Adna Chaffee. She was born in Ravenna, Ohio, July 21, 1932. She was proceeded in death by her parents and siblings; Vernita C Nail, Richard W. Chaffee, Ruth J. Reilly and her foster brother, B. Wilfred Wilenius.

Merilyn attended Baldwin-Wallace University in Berea, Ohio and graduated from Saint Luke’s School of Nursing (Case Western Reserve) in 1954.

Merilyn is survived by the love of her life, Dr. David M. Richards and in August celebrated with her family sixty-five wonderful adventure filled years. Together they have three children. Mrs. Diane R. (Eric) Budendorf; Dr. David R. Richards (Michelle); Dr. Dale R. Richards. Grandchildren: Dr. Deric R. (Alison R.) Budendorf; Mr. Andrew D. (Sydney A.) Budendorf; Morgan E. Richards and Adrian M. Kalnas; Ms. Sydney E. Richards; Ms. Sarah A. Richards; Great Grandchildren: Cameron D. Budendorf; Aurora L. Budendorf. Her Sister-In-Law, Lois E. Chaffee and many adored Nieces and Nephews. Merilyn’s passion and pride was her precious family.

She was always involved in many activities throughout her life. Most important to her was serving her Church and supporting her husband in his profession through The Osteopathic Advocates, (she served as President of both Ohio and Texas State Auxiliaries.) She served as “First Lady” to the Presidency at The University of North Texas Health Science Center, During her husband’s tenure as its President from 1986-1999. Merilyn received the Yellow Rose of Texas Honorary designation from the Governor of Texas and The University of north Texas Founder’s Medal.
